Reimagining Exposure Therapy for Anxiousness and Phobias

Perhaps the most founded application of VR in mental wellness is for treating anxiety Conditions and specific phobias. Conventional publicity therapy—progressively confronting feared situations in authentic everyday living—could be logistically complicated, pricey, and overwhelming for people. VR delivers an elegant solution to these boundaries.

For someone with aerophobia (concern of flying), VR can simulate the entire flying encounter—from boarding and takeoff to turbulence and landing—with no at any time leaving the therapist's Office environment. Equally, folks with acrophobia (anxiety of heights) can nearly stand atop skyscrapers or cross bridges, while Those people with social panic can apply community speaking before virtual audiences of varying measurements and responsiveness.

The great thing about VR publicity lies in its specific controllability. Therapists can adjust the depth of experiences to match Just about every patient's therapeutic pace, developing a graduated technique that builds self esteem methodically. Scientific studies have revealed that VR publicity therapy can be as efficient as conventional exposure techniques, With all the added great things about privacy, convenience, and reduced dropout fees.

Addressing Depression As a result of Digital Environments

Depression remedy by way of VR normally takes a distinct but equally ground breaking solution. For individuals struggling with melancholy, VR can produce positively reinforcing environments that would be challenging to access inside their existing point out. Virtual normal settings with calming things like forests, seashores, or mountain landscapes can activate the parasympathetic nervous procedure, minimizing stress and increasing temper.

Past passive activities, VR also allows interactive eventualities that counter depressive thought patterns. Packages may perhaps manual end users as a result of mindfulness workout routines in serene virtual areas or facilitate cognitive behavioral therapy (CBT) approaches in environments designed to obstacle negative assumptions. Some applications even use avatar-primarily based interactions to aid sufferers identify and reshape their responses to triggering predicaments.

What would make VR significantly important for melancholy is its capability to engage patients who experience emotionally detached or absence enthusiasm. The immersive nature of VR can quickly bypass apathy, developing windows of option for therapeutic intervention That may or else be shut.

Pressure Reduction Via Digital Worlds

In our superior-strain world, Long-term anxiety has an effect on virtually Everybody at some point. VR delivers scientifically-backed approaches to pressure administration that transcend standard leisure procedures.

Virtual environments created especially for worry reduction usually integrate biofeedback mechanisms, where physiological markers like heart charge variability or skin conductance are monitored even though buyers navigate calming eventualities. This genuine-time opinions results in a strong Mastering loop, encouraging people acknowledge and regulate their tension responses a lot more properly.

Corporate wellness plans and healthcare amenities have begun implementing VR peace stations where by workforce or clients usually takes small "mental holidays"—suffering from tranquil Seashore sunsets, tranquil mountain meadows, or maybe guided meditation periods in unique spots. Analysis indicates that even brief VR rest classes can drastically decrease cortisol concentrations and subjective pressure scores.

The Therapeutic Mechanism: Why VR Will work

What helps make VR uniquely helpful for mental wellbeing therapy is its unparalleled power to produce existence—the psychological emotion of "getting there" during the virtual setting. This perception of presence engages emotional and sensory processing in approaches comparable to real encounters, activating neural pathways suitable to therapeutic change.

Additionally, the gamification features frequently incorporated into VR therapy capitalize to the brain's reward programs, raising motivation and therapy adherence. When progress is visualized and achievements are celebrated within the Digital ecosystem, people expertise fast positive reinforcement that traditional therapy occasionally struggles to provide.

Limits and Long run Directions

Regardless of its assure, VR therapy just isn't with no restrictions. Components expenditures have historically been prohibitive, even though rates continue to minimize as know-how improvements. Some users encounter check here "cybersickness"—movement sickness induced by VR—although enhanced components and considerate design and style are reducing this problem. On top of that, although spectacular, existing proof continue to consists largely of lesser scientific studies; larger sized randomized managed trials are required to fully set up efficacy across diverse ailments and populations.

The way forward for VR therapy looks terribly bright. As synthetic intelligence is significantly built-in with VR, we are going to likely see much more adaptive therapeutic experiences that adjust in real-time to consumer responses. Teletherapy programs will increase, making it possible for men and women in remote spots to entry specialized VR treatments Earlier offered only in urban facilities. Most exciting is definitely the possible for home-dependent VR therapy as an adjunct to common sessions, extending therapeutic intervention further than the clinical placing.
